Abstract:
The present invention provides a pervaporation membrane suitable for long-term operation of separating a volatile organic compound from an aqueous solution containing the organic compound. A pervaporation membrane 10A according to the present invention comprises a separation function layer 1 containing a silicone resin. The ratio R of a value obtained by subtracting a Young's modulus A1 (MPa) of the separation function layer 1 before conducting the following test from a Young's modulus A2 (MPa) of the separation function layer 1 after the test is conducted, with respect to the Young's modulus A1, is equal to or more than -30%. Test: The separation function layer 1 is immersed in a liquid mixture L formed of n-butanol and water for three weeks. The separation function layer 1 is removed from the liquid mixture L and is dried. Here, the n-butanol content of the liquid mixture L is 1.0 wt%, and the temperature of the liquid mixture L is 80°C.
